Why These Are the Top Bathroom Remodeling Contractors in Pembroke Township

** The bathroom remodeling market in and around Pembroke Township is characterized by a modest level of competition, primarily from established contractors based in the nearby commercial hubs of Kankakee, Bourbonnais, and Bradley. Due to the rural nature of the township, residents typically rely on these regional service providers who are willing to travel. The average quality of work is good, with several long-standing businesses building their reputation on word-of-mouth and local community ties. Competition is not saturated, allowing reputable contractors to maintain steady business. Pricing is generally moderate and in line with regional Midwest averages, but can vary significantly based on material choices and the scope of plumbing/structural work. A standard bathroom remodel with mid-range materials typically starts in the **$8,000 - $15,000** range, while high-end custom projects or those involving significant layout changes and accessibility features can easily exceed **$25,000**. Homeowners are advised to obtain multiple detailed quotes and verify both licensing and insurance before proceeding with any project.

Frequently Asked Questions About Bathroom Remodeling in Pembroke Township

Get answers to common questions about bathroom remodeling services in Pembroke Township, Illinois.

1What is a realistic budget range for a full bathroom remodel in Pembroke Township, and what factors influence the cost here?

For a full remodel in our area, homeowners can expect a range from $15,000 for a basic update to $40,000+ for high-end custom work. Key local cost factors include the need for skilled contractors who may travel from larger nearby towns, potential well water system considerations for plumbing updates, and material choices that can withstand Illinois' significant humidity swings. Always get 2-3 detailed, written estimates from local providers.

2How does the Illinois climate and Pembroke Township's rural setting impact material choices for a bathroom remodel?

Our humid summers and cold winters make moisture-resistant and temperature-stable materials essential. We recommend porcelain tile over solid hardwood, which can warp, and properly vented exhaust fans to manage humidity. For rural properties on septic systems, selecting low-flow toilets and showerheads is not just eco-friendly but also crucial for preventing system strain, which is a key local consideration.

3What should I look for when choosing a bathroom remodeling contractor in the Pembroke Township area?

Prioritize contractors licensed in Illinois and insured, and verify they have experience with the specific plumbing and electrical work common in our older rural homes. Ask for references from local projects you can visit, and confirm they will pull all required Kankakee County building permits. A reputable local contractor will understand well and septic system interfaces, which is vital for proper installation.

4What is the typical timeline for a bathroom renovation in this region, and are there seasonal timing considerations?

A full remodel typically takes 3-6 weeks from demolition to completion. It's wise to schedule major plumbing work outside of peak winter months (Dec-Feb) to avoid complications from frozen ground if exterior access is needed. Spring and early fall are ideal, allowing for proper ventilation during painting and adhesive curing despite our seasonal humidity.

5Are there any local permit or inspection requirements in Pembroke Township I should be aware of before starting?

Yes, most structural, plumbing, and electrical work requires a permit from Kankakee County Building Department. This ensures work meets Illinois state codes, which is critical for safety and future home resale. Your contractor should handle this, but as the homeowner, you are ultimately responsible for ensuring permits are closed with a final inspection, especially for any electrical updates near water sources.
